    Automatically activates gate operators "hands-free" when a vehicle approaches. Designed for residential, agricultural, and commercial applications. Easy to install. Avoid the headaches associated with installing exit and entry loop detector systems, installs in 1/3 the time.

    The exit wand is an electromagnetic sensor that detects metal mass in motion providing a 12 foot radius of detection that allows hands free exit from automatic gate operators.

    The MightyMule/GTO Exit Wand has very low power consumption with a wide input voltage range that makes it ideal for battery applications. It is designed to reject line noise of 50 Hz or 60 Hz to improve its detection compatibilities near power lines.

    Note: Exit wands / sensors should not be used on properties in which the driveway gate is designed to keep in pets, children or live stock due to possibility for unintentional openings. Our suggestion is to use a keypad for exiting so the gate will only open when it is intended to by code.

       Loop Placement Formula Top of Page

    Use this formula to calculate how far from the gate the loops should be place so that by the time a car reaches the gate, the gate will be completely open:

    Exit Loop formula: x*(y*1.46)=z
    x = time for gate to open in seconds.
    y = Desired MPH to reach gate.
    z = how far from gate.

    FYI - 1.46 converts miles per hour to feet per second. We also recommend adding in 10 to 20 feet so the gate is fully open at comfortable distance from the gate.

    For placement of a safety loop before and after the gate use the formula below. A safety loop is designed to stop the motion of the gate before the car reaches the gate. The distance below should give an ample amount of time for the gate to stop before hitting a vehicle:

    Safety Formula: 4 feet before a closed gate and after an opened gate.


       Words from Senior Application Engineer, Anthony Gaeto Top of Page

    “We are always getting questions about how gate exit wands work and how they are different from exit loops.

    Exit wands are what is know as a magnetometer which senses changes in the Earth’s magnetic field. An easy way to explain how exit wands work is to picture a boat traveling through the water. As the boat is traveling it is creating waves. As your car travels through the magnetic field of the Earth it creates similar waves, like the boat. The exit wand’s magnetometer picks up on these waves as you travel by the wand. One downside of exit wands is that they do loose sight of your vehicle when it is stopped.

    Gate Crafters carries 5 different types of exit wands that work very similar to each other. The only difference between these wands are some of their features. The GTO/PRO wireless exit wand is wireless between the magnetometer and receiver. The Gate Crafters exit wand is manufactured by EMX and has been around for years. The GTO exit wand is recommend for use with other GTO openers and accessories. The Estate Swing exit wand does come with a range control board that allow you to adjust the sensitivity of the magnetometer. This feature allows you tune down the range of the exit wand, so that vehicles such as a lawn mower doesn't set open your gate, but this isn't a complete failsafe, as it will still operate the gate opener when something is nearby. The Estate Swing Deluxe Exit wand is the most different from the other exit wands. It is constructed out of copper and features a ground cable that attach to a grounding rod that helps protect this exit wand from lightning strikes. The other 4 exit wands do not have this feature and are susceptible to damage from lightning strikes. Also the Estate Swing Deluxe Exit Wand comes with a 5 year warranty, which is longer than any other exit wand we sell.

    Exit loops differ from exit wands in that they are buried in the driveway in a loop and are wire to the gate opener. The way exit loops work is that they detect the presence of metal (your car) above the loop. It does not matter if your car is moving or not, the loop will detect the car. Besides being used to exit your property, exit loops are used for safety. When exit loops are used a safety device, they will prevent your gate from closing on your car, when it detect a car nearby to your gate. The exit loop is wired to a exit loop detector, which is then wired into your gate opener’s control board.

    Which automatic driveway gate opener to use with a wood gate?

    Privacy fences usually don't work well with swing automatic driveway gate openers because the solid surface acts as a "sail" in the wind. 

    This adds strain to the motor of the automatic driveway gate opener and generally trips safety sensors that are a part of all automatic driveway gate opener systems. Either you can use an automatic slide driveway gate opener or you would have to manually operate a swing driveway gate opener in windy conditions. It would also be recommended to use an automatic driveway gate lock to lock your driveway gate shut in the closed position. This takes pressure off of the automatic driveway gate opener’s arm when the wind pushes against the driveway gate.

    The easiest automatic driveway gate opener to manually operate would be the Estate Swing E-S 1600/1602 automatic driveway gate opener. The Estate Swing E-S 1600/1602 automatic driveway gate opener has a key release on the top that releases the gears and allows the driveway gate to be moved manually without having to remove the automatic driveway gate opener.
